A sunken garden is a shallow, edged dip with a drainage plan and layered soil so plants sit lower than the yard without turning into a puddle.
A sunken garden gives a flat yard depth and definition. Step down a few inches and the space feels like its own little room. It can also slow runoff that used to skim across the surface.
Decide What Your Sunken Garden Will Do
Pick the main job first. That choice drives depth, drainage needs, and what you plant.
- Garden room: Planted edges with a stable floor for a bench or stepping path.
- Planted basin: A shallow depression planted wall-to-wall that takes bursts of rain.
For most yards, a finished depth of 10–18 in feels like a real step-down without creating a steep edge. If your yard stays wet after rain, keep the first build closer to 6–12 in and plan a stronger drain layer.
Pick A Location That Won’t Fight You
Choose a spot you’ll see and use. Then run these checks.
Stay Clear Of Foundations
Keep the basin away from the house. A sunken area belongs out in the yard, not near the foundation zone.
Read The Yard After Rain
Walk the yard during or right after a steady rain. Notice where water enters your chosen area and where it leaves. If the site stays wet for days, plan on an outlet drain or pick a higher spot.
Do A Simple Drain Test
Dig a test hole 12 in deep and about a shovel-width across. Fill it with water, let it drain, then fill it again. Time how long the second fill takes to drop.
If the water level barely moves after a few hours, your soil drains slowly. You can still build a sunken garden, but you’ll need gravel storage and a way for excess water to leave.
Lay Out The Shape With Markers You Can Move
Use a garden hose, string lines, or marking paint. Keep shifting the outline until it looks right from the windows and paths you use most.
Plan an entry. A wide step built from pavers or a flat stone is safer than a narrow drop, especially after rain.
Excavate In Layers And Save Your Best Soil
Cut the outline with a spade. Remove turf in squares and set it aside if you want to reuse it. Separate what you dig:
- Top layer: Darker soil from the top 6–10 in. Save this for your planting blend.
- Lower layer: Denser subsoil. Use it elsewhere, not in the new bed.
Dig to the planned depth plus any base layers. If your finished depth is 12 in and you want 4 in of gravel under the soil, excavate close to 16 in.
Keep the bottom slightly sloped toward one low point. A gentle fall of 1–2 in across the basin is enough to stop random puddles.
Build Drainage Like You Mean It
You’re building a low area on purpose, so water needs a plan before plants go in.
Option 1: In-Place Soak
Use this when your drain test shows a steady drop and the basin is shallow.
Option 2: Gravel Storage Layer
Add 3–6 in of clean, washed gravel on the bottom, then cover it with a permeable fabric to keep soil from sliding into the stones.
Option 3: Outlet Drain
A perforated pipe set in gravel can collect water and carry it to a safe discharge point downhill. Choose An Edge That Holds The Shape
The edge is the frame. It also stops soil from slumping back into the basin.
- Stone or brick: Stable and tidy when set on compacted base.
- Timber: Easy to build; stake it well and brace corners.
- Steel edging: Clean line and low profile for shallow basins.
- Turf edge: Blends into lawn; it needs trimming to stay crisp.
Mix Soil That Drains Yet Stays Friendly To Roots
Backfill a little high, then top up after the first season once settling slows.
A reliable planting blend for many yards is:
- 2 parts screened topsoil
- 1 part finished compost
- 1 part coarse sand or fine gravel (skip this if your native soil is already sandy)

Materials And Specs For A Clean Build
This table keeps the build choices in one place so you can measure and buy with fewer surprises.
| Build Element | Common Range | Notes |
|---|---|---|
| Finished depth | 6–18 in | Shallow is easier to drain; deeper creates a stronger room feel. |
| Bottom grade | 1–2 in fall | Slope toward one low point so water doesn’t pick random puddle spots. |
| Gravel layer | 3–6 in | Washed gravel stores water below roots when soil drains slowly. |
| Fabric overlap | 6–8 in | Overlap seams so soil can’t slip into the gravel layer. |
| Soil backfill lift | 4–6 in | Backfill in layers and water between lifts for even settling. |
| Mulch depth | 1–2 in | Mulch reduces splash and helps stop surface crust. |
| Edge base | 2–4 in compacted | Stone and pavers last longer with a compacted base under them. |
| Outlet pipe slope | Steady fall downhill | Keep the run sloped so water doesn’t sit in the line after storms. |
Build The Sunken Garden Step By Step
Step 1: Set The Drain Layer
Spread washed gravel, rake it level, and tamp it with your boots. Lay permeable fabric over it with overlapped seams. If you’re adding pipe, set it in gravel and aim it toward the outlet point.
Step 2: Install And Brace The Edge
Set your edging on compacted base. Check the line from multiple angles. Fix wobbles now, not after planting.
Step 3: Backfill With Soil In Lifts
Add soil blend in 4–6 in lifts. Water lightly after each lift. Stop when the finished grade sits 1–2 in higher than you want long-term.
Step 4: Create The Floor And Entry
For a garden room, set a small gravel pad or stepping stones. For a planted basin, shape a gentle bowl with the lowest point where water enters. Build the entry step with pavers on compacted base so it stays flat.
Step 5: Plant By Moisture Zone
The lower center stays moist longer, the rim dries faster. Plant to match and you’ll replace fewer plants later.
Pick Plants With A Clear Plan
If you’re in the United States, start with cold tolerance. The USDA Plant Hardiness Zone Map is the standard reference for matching plants to winter minimum temperatures.
Next, match roots to moisture. A plant that hates wet feet won’t forgive a basin floor, even with gravel below it.
Plant Placement And What Each Zone Likes
Use this placement table as a starting point. Swap in local favorites that fit the same moisture level and light.
| Zone In The Basin | Moisture Pattern | Plant Types That Fit |
|---|---|---|
| Center low point | Wet after storms | Sedges, moisture-tolerant perennials, many irises |
| Lower slope | Evenly moist | Most hardy perennials, clumping grasses, ferns in shade |
| Upper slope | Moist then dries | Perennials that like good drainage, low shrubs |
| Rim | Drier, warmer | Drought-tough plants, herbs, groundcovers |
| Entry edge | Foot traffic | Low groundcovers, tough perennials, small gravel strip |
Finish Details That Keep It Tidy
- Mulch lightly: A thin layer cuts splash and slows weeds.
- Define the rim: A stone cap or narrow gravel strip keeps the edge sharp.
- Add a seat: A bench on two pavers turns the space into a hangout.
Water slowly for the first few weeks so roots chase down into the new soil. Then ease off and let plants settle into their normal rhythm.
Fix Problems Before They Spread
Water Pools For Too Long
Rake back mulch and break any crust with a hand fork. Clear leaves at the inlet. If the basin still holds water after rain, add an outlet drain or rebuild the bottom with more gravel storage.
Edges Shift After A Season
Reset the moved section and rebuild the base under it. Add bracing stakes on timber edges and reset any loose bricks or stones.
